First up, at number three, we have the Kia Stinger GT. This sleek sports sedan is like Starbuck from Battlestar Galactica—bold, daring, and impossible to ignore. With its turbocharged engine and rear-wheel-drive setup, the Stinger GT is built for performance. It’s not just about speed though; the interior is packed with premium materials, tech features, and enough comfort to make you feel like you’re in a much pricier car. Some critics argue it’s not as refined as European competitors, but for the price, it’s hard to beat. If you want a Kia that screams sporty sophistication, the Stinger GT is your ride.
At number two, we’ve got the Kia Carnival. Now, hear me out before you roll your eyes at the word “minivan.” The Carnival isn’t your grandma’s people hauler—it’s more like Apollo, understated but incredibly capable. This isn’t just any minivan; it’s a luxury lounge on wheels. With its plush seating, high-end finishes, and cutting-edge tech, the Carnival redefines what a family vehicle can be. It’s perfect for road trips, carpool duty, or even impressing your friends at the school pickup line. Sure, it’s pricey for a Kia, but compared to other luxury vans, it’s a steal.
Finally, taking the crown at number one is the Kia EV6 GT. Oh boy, this one is pure Admiral Adama—commanding, futuristic, and dripping with innovation. The EV6 GT is Kia’s electric flagship, and it’s here to prove that eco-friendly doesn’t mean boring. With lightning-fast acceleration, a stunning design, and a cabin that feels like something out of a sci-fi movie, this car is a game-changer. It’s loaded with features like advanced driver assistance systems, a massive infotainment screen, and an impressive range for an EV. Yes, it’s the most expensive Kia you can buy, but it’s also one of the coolest electric vehicles on the market today.
